We offer performance opportunities for ages 5 to 18, which include not only acting, but also participation in a socially creative experience, which fosters teamwork,confidence building and self-expression. Our weekly classes offer a mix of drama/musical theatre skills.There are two major productions annually, a Summer show and a Pantomime. Both members and non-members are invited to audition.

Financial health, per its FY2025 accounts

The accounts state that the charity delivered a surplus of £2,261 for the year ended 31 August 2025, despite facing cost-of-living pressures and rising overheads. The Chair's report confirms the organization remains financially stable and committed to its mission. An independent examiner confirmed that no material matters came to attention regarding the accounts or accounting records.
